Dynamic cooling load calculation course now available in e-learning!
In this course, we will show you how to use the LINEAR Building Cooling Dynamic module. Together we will create a dynamic cooling load calculation in accordance with ASHRAE and VDI 2078. The courses are available to all LINEAR customers free of charge.

At the beginning of the course, we will show you the user interface of the module. The intuitive UI will help you to quickly find your way around.
We will then go into the basic settings that you can define for your project.
By creating different usage and temperature profiles, you can view each room individually.
You have the option of selecting from various sources as well as from weather data already included in the software to map the exact location of your project.
We then look at the log analyses and look specifically at the enveloping surface settings.
With the help of the window configurator, you can realistically visualize all the window systems used in the project.
We also show you the details of all internal loads. Here you can define load profiles for people, lighting, machinery and equipment, infiltration and throughput rate and assign them to the individual rooms.
The results can be printed out and evaluated as a diagram in the software.
The annual simulation is also part of the Building Cooling Dynamic module. We will demonstrate the application and analyze the results.
